The protest led the arrival of Anthony Blinken, secretary of the US Department of State, in Malacañang on March 19. Blinken was in the country to help Ferdinand Marcos Jr. and the AFP in the upcoming Balikatan Wargames and to push Indo-Pacific Security again Strategy, the US strategy for maintaining its hegemony in Asia against China's rival.

Prior to Blinken, the high economic and military officials of the US had almost arrived in the country this March.

Gina Raimondo, secretary of the US Department of Commerce, led the delegation of the US Presidential Trade and Investment Mission sent by the US to raise the Indo-Pacific Economic Framework, a "key" part of the Indo-Pacific Security Strategy. Raimondo's delegation includes 22 leaders of big American companies, including two construction companies (Bechtel, Black & amp; Veatch) locals of US military bases and military facilities in various countries.

Adm. John C. Aquilino, commander of the US Indo-Pacific Command, for meetings with Marcos, defense secretary Gilbert Teodoro and AFP chief Gen. Romeo Brawner JR, along with other high AFP officials.

They have taken preparations for Balikatan 2024, boasting that it will be the "largest" in its history. It will be launched in Batanes and Palawan from April 22 to May 8. One of its "highlights" is "Integrated Air Missile Defense Exercise," or flying missiles in China's direction. This is in accordance with the Philippines' strategic defense strategy and role as a defense of the US first-island chain.
